English Dachshunds sold for nearly $17,000 during the epidemic, an 89% increase
** CCTV Finance (reporter Wang Yongxi)** A survey has found that the price of puppies from Britain’s most popular breed has reached record levels, according to the website of Sky News UK. According to the data, the average price of a Dachshund rose to £1,838 in June this year, up 89 percent from £973 in March. English and French bulldog prices have also risen sharply. A review of advertisements on some of the UK’s largest classified advertising sites over the past three years shows that the prices of English pugs, dachshunds and poodles have never been higher.
